Solved: mini cassette tapes to a CD
Is there a device I can buy that will enable me to record my mini cassette tapes onto a CD?

Several years ago, I used my old sony walkman with rca cable plugged into the headphone port connecting to the microphone plug on the tower, to transfer music to the computer and later burned the music to a cd. I used the free program Audacity to convert it to mp3 format. Very easy to use.
Oh, I used a splitter so I could hear the music thru the headphones while copying.
Audacity is available for free download at www.majorgeeks.com or www.download.com.
